Tickets Go on Sale Jan. 14, 2026 for the Northwest Soiree: A Garden Gala

by Sarah Smith-Hutchinson

Senatobia, MS (01/14/2026) — Tickets go on sale at noon on January 14 for the Northwest Mississippi Community College Foundation's premier fundraising event the Northwest Soiree: A Garden Gala presented by Mini Systems. This event is set to take place at the Heindl Center for the Performing Arts on April 18, 2026.

The headliner for the event is pop singer Dave Barnes, who will perform after the awards' ceremony.

Barnes has been a singer-songwriter since his years in Mississippi where he grew an attachment to hip-hop, soul, blues and R&B. After years of being a fan of music, while at Middle Tennessee State University he began writing songs for other artists.

One of his most popular tunes, "God Gave Me You" became a smash hit on Blake Shelton's "Red River Blue" album. Barnes has over 100 songs recorded from a variety of artists including Florida Georgia Line, Tim McGraw, Reba McEntire, Dan + Shay, Carrie Underwood, NEEDTOBREATHE, Billy Currington, and many more.

"We are thrilled to welcome Dave Barnes and his band to Northwest for our Garden Gala," said Patti Gordon, executive director of the Institutional Advancement. "His Mississippi roots, incredible talent, and meaningful lyrics make him the perfect headliner for an evening that celebrates the college's vision of transforming students' lives, enriching our communities, and striving for excellence in our educational programs and services. Every ticket purchased helps open doors for our students and strengthens the legacy of Northwest."

There are two ticket pricing options that feature a performance by Dave Barnes. The premium ticket includes a social hour and awards ceremony starting at 6 PM; formal attire is requested. The standard ticket that is the performance only starting at 8:30 PM.
